Youth Juggling Academy Achievement Badge Program for IJA Members of all Ages, with Prizes!

The IJA Youth Juggling Academy (formerly known as the IJA Youth Education Program or “YEP”) is launching an exciting new achievement recognition program! This program is not just for kids; adult IJA members can earn achievement badges, too.
